Key Differences in Gambling Laws
One of the most significant differences in global gambling laws is the distinction between online and offline gambling. For instance, many European countries have adopted progressive online gambling frameworks, recognizing the industry’s potential for economic growth. This is in stark contrast to places like China, where almost all forms of gambling are illegal except for state-run lotteries and specific betting activities.
The legal age for gambling also varies widely. In many regions, the minimum age is set at eighteen, while in others, it is twenty-one or higher. These age restrictions reflect a nation’s approach to protecting its youth and ensuring responsible gambling practices are prioritized.
Challenges in Regulating Online Gambling
The rise of the internet has transformed the gambling landscape, leading to challenges in regulation. Online gambling often operates outside traditional jurisdictional boundaries, making it difficult for individual countries to enforce their laws effectively. This has resulted in a complex scenario where players can easily access offshore gambling sites that may not comply with local regulations.
Moreover, issues such as cybersecurity and payment processing complicate regulatory efforts. As countries work to create a safe online gambling environment, they must contend with the realities of digital anonymity and the potential for fraud. Countries are increasingly focusing on developing robust frameworks that balance accessibility with security for players.
The Role of Government and Licensing Authorities
Governments play a crucial role in the regulation of gambling by establishing licensing authorities that oversee the operation of gambling entities. These authorities are responsible for ensuring that casinos, online platforms, and other gambling services comply with local laws and maintain fair practices. In many jurisdictions, a rigorous application process is required, which includes background checks and financial disclosures to prevent corruption and fraud.
Licensing not only helps safeguard players but also generates significant tax revenue for governments. This revenue can be allocated to public services, such as education and healthcare, thereby reinforcing the argument for the regulated legalization of gambling. However, authorities must remain vigilant to combat illegal operations that can undermine the integrity of the regulated market.
Responsible Gambling and Player Protection
As gambling becomes more prevalent, the need for responsible gambling measures grows increasingly important. Many countries have implemented programs aimed at educating players about the risks of gambling and providing support for those who may develop problems. These initiatives often include self-exclusion options and access to counseling services to help individuals manage their gambling habits.
Additionally, gambling operators are increasingly required to implement measures that promote responsible gaming. This can include offering deposit limits, time-out options, and providing information on the odds of games. By fostering a safe gaming environment, countries can help mitigate the negative impacts associated with gambling while still allowing individuals to enjoy their leisure activities.
